On 3/2/19 3:20 PM, Aditya Pakki wrote: > Allocating memory via kzalloc for phi may fail and causes a > NULL pointer dereference. This patch avoids such a scenario. >
Was this detected by Coccinelle?
If so, please mention it in the commit log.
Thanks -- Gustavo
> Signed-off-by: Aditya Pakki <pakki001@umn.edu> > --- > drivers/isdn/hardware/mISDN/hfcsusb.c | 3 +++ > 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+) > > diff --git a/drivers/isdn/hardware/mISDN/hfcsusb.c b/drivers/isdn/hardware/mISDN/hfcsusb.c > index 124ff530da82..26e3182bbca8 100644 > --- a/drivers/isdn/hardware/mISDN/hfcsusb.c > +++ b/drivers/isdn/hardware/mISDN/hfcsusb.c > @@ -263,6 +263,9 @@ hfcsusb_ph_info(struct hfcsusb *hw) > int i; > > phi = kzalloc(struct_size(phi, bch, dch->dev.nrbchan), GFP_ATOMIC); > + if (!phi) > + return; > + > phi->dch.ch.protocol = hw->protocol; > phi->dch.ch.Flags = dch->Flags; > phi->dch.state = dch->state; >
